환경 변수를 Emulator로 설정하는 방법


환경 변수를 Emulator로 설정하는 방법


Emulaator 및 공식 환경 전환에 환경 변수를 사용하려는 경우
나는 그 방법을 남겼다.

환경 변수 설정 방법

  • 환경 변수 설정
  • firebase functions:config:set use.emulator="false"
    
    CLI는 위에서 설명한 대로 설정할 수 있습니다.
    주의점은 use.emulator처럼 {小文字}.{小文字}의format 설정을 통과해야 한다.
  • 설계
  • 다음 명령을 누르면 디버깅을 완성할 수 있습니다.
    환경 변수를 다시 설정하려면 매번 디버깅을 해야 합니다.
    firebase deploy --only functions
    
  • 환경 변수 획득 방법
  • import * as functions from "firebase-functions";
    functions.config().use.emulator
    

    Emultator 사용 가능 방법


    설정된 config를 가져와서 생성.runtimeconfig.jsonEmulaator에서 사용할 수 있습니다.
    # functions ディレクトリで実行
    firebase functions:config:get > .runtimeconfig.json
    

    참고 자료


    환경 구성 | Firebase
    로컬에서 함수 실행하기

    좋은 웹페이지 즐겨찾기